WebMilk and dairy products, meat, whole grains and cola are all high phosphorus foods. Meat is an excellent protein source while you are on dialysis, so other foods high in phosphorus should be eaten in moderation 5. Limit dairy products to one serving per day. WebDialysis-friendly side dishes include steamed rice, buttered noodles or pasta, a small green salad with low-sodium dressing and coleslaw. Low-potassium vegetables are also a good side order. These include green beans, carrots, summer squash, corn and cauliflower.

WebFor people with CKD stage 4-5 or who are on dialysis, it is a good practice to limit dairy to ½-1 cup per day. Of course, you should ask your dietitian what’s best for you. Rice and almond milk are lower in phosphorus compared to cow’s milk and make excellent substitutes. But, be careful to avoid artificial phosphorus in the brand that you buy!
